Rethinking the Research Culture | Challenges in Academia with Dr. Haage #6
Dr. Verena Haage joins us for a deep and honest conversation about the systemic problems in academia, beyond just publishing or funding.
We unpack the urgent need to rethink research culture, covering issues like:
-Burnout, mental health, and unrealistic career expectations
-The shortage of stable positions like staff scientists
-Why retreats often miss opportunities for genuine connection
Dr. Haage shares actionable ideas, such as creating peer spaces and a trust-based lab culture to rethink what mentorship and leadership should look like in modern science.
